The combination of student loans for college or graduate degrees with the high cost of living in cities where most theaters are located slows access to the theater field for those with no independent means to support themselves through years of low wages while climbing the leadership ladder. There is, among others, the holiday slot, for Christmas or family shows; the musical slot; the Shakespeare slot; and the imprudently coined ethnic slot. The ethnic slot is where a theaters production is placed when it is outside the normthat is, nonwhiteand is therefore unfamiliar. The League of Resident Theatres ( LORT) is the largest professional theater association of its kind in the United States, with 75 member theaters located in every major market in the U.S., including 29 states and the District of Columbia.
